English Pronunciation for Spanish Speakers

English pronunciation for Spanish speakers. If Spanish is your native language, this video will help you to fix a common mistakes that Spanish speakers make when they're speaking English. When the letter S is at the beginning of a word and the following letter is a consonant, make sure that you don't add an extra vowel sound before the word. For example, don't say "estudy". Don't take a breath before you say the word. Just start saying the "s". Watch this video for other examples.

Couch Potatoes

A couch is a sofa, such as people have in their sitting-rooms, often in front of the television. Some people spend a lot of time sitting on the couch watching television, and probably getting fat for want of exercise. We have a name for such people in English – couch potatoes. And, as British people are well known for watching TV a lot, perhaps we are a nation of couch potatoes. Google, the company that runs the internet search engine, has just published a survey which claims that British people now spend more time on the internet than they do watching television – 164 minutes a day on average on the internet, 148 minutes watching television.
